This auction is for a new Atlantis Slip lanyard. This auction is for 1 BURGUNDY/BLACK Lanyard.
This lanyars slips easily on and off, very comfortable and light weight. Comes standard with a whistle. Lanyard cord can be unclipped and clipped on the life vest. This Lanyard will fit all Kawasaki models with Lanyard switch, Also Fits All Polaris, Wet Jet & Tiger Shark models with clip typle lanyard switch. |

Future products: Mercedes-Benz plans B-class coupe, crossover, sedan
Mon, 30 Aug 2010Mercedes-Benz is set to launch a wave of small luxury vehicles in the United States. An all-new C-class coupe will debut next year, followed by three derivatives of the front-wheel-drive B class in 2012 and 2013. "Everyone wants to be Mercedes-Benz," said Ernst Lieb, CEO of Mercedes-Benz USA.
VW Polo unveiled at Geneva motor show 2009
Mon, 02 Mar 2009By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 02 March 2009 20:04 VW tonight issued these first photos of the new Polo Mk5 on the eve of its Geneva motor show debut. And the latest Polo supermini is every inch the shrunken Golf hatchback we were expecting – it looks like a Golf the cat sat on. One of the headlines is that they've cut the kerb weight by 8% over the outgoing Polo.
Who's Where: Gorden Wagener to head Mercedes Advanced Design NA
Mon, 20 Feb 2006German designer Gorden Wagener, 37, has been appointed President of Mercedes-Benz Advanced Design of North America. Beginning his new position on January 1. 2006, Wagener now focuses on products specifically for North America, including production and show cars as well as advanced projects.
